Demographics details for Yankton, SD vs Purcell, OK

Population Overview

Compare main population characteristics in Yankton, SD vs Purcell, OK.

Data Yankton Purcell
Population 15,534 6,762
Median Age 39.9 years 34.7 years
Median Income $60,180 $68,295
Married Families 37.0% 37.0%
Poverty Level 12% 12%
Unemployment Rate 3.6 3.6

Population Comparison: Yankton vs Purcell

  • In Yankton, the population is higher at 15,534, compared to 6,762 in Purcell.
  • Residents in Yankton have a higher median age of 39.9 years compared to 34.7 years in Purcell.
  • Purcell has a higher median income of $68,295, compared to $60,180 in Yankton.
  • The percentage of married families is the same in both Yankton and Purcell at 37.0%.
  • The poverty level is identical in both Yankton and Purcell at 12%.
  • The unemployment rate is the same in both Yankton and Purcell at 3.6%.

Health Statistics

The health statistics provide insights into prevalent health conditions in two communities.

Health Metric Yankton Purcell
Mental Health Not Good 13.9% 18.6%
Physical Health Not Good 9.9% 13.5%
Depression 17.9% 25.3%
Smoking 18.3% 21.0%
Binge Drinking 20.3% 14.4%
Obesity 37.9% 42.7%
Disability Percentage 16.0% 15.0%

Health Statistics Comparison: Yankton vs Purcell

  • In Purcell, a higher percentage report poor mental health at 18.6% compared to 13.9% in Yankton.
  • Higher depression rates are seen in Purcell at 25.3% versus 17.9% in Yankton.
  • Purcell has a higher smoking rate at 21.0% compared to 18.3% in Yankton.
  • Binge drinking is more common in Yankton at 20.3% compared to 14.4% in Purcell.
  • Purcell has higher obesity rates at 42.7% compared to 37.9% in Yankton.
  • Disability percentages are higher in Yankton at 16.0% compared to 15.0% in Purcell.
